(CNN) - President Obama made two top nominations on Wednesday: Tom Wheeler, a top fund-raiser for the president's re-election campaign and a telecommunications policy expert, to head the Federal Communications Commission, and U.S. Rep. Mel Watt, D-North Carolina, to direct the Federal Housing Finance Agency.
